THE COMPENSATION

The typical hiring range for this position is $100,000–$150,000 CAD per year. The final agreed upon salary may vary based on factors such as job-related knowledge, skills and experience. If applicable additionally, this position may be eligible for bonus and equity.

We are always looking for top talent. If your qualifications differ from those listed above, the scope of work and final agreed upon salary may be adjusted to reflect your individual qualifications.

What you need to know about the Vancouver Tech Scene

Raincouver, Vancity, The Big Smoke — Vancouver is known by many names, and in recent years, it has gained a reputation as a growing hub for both tech and sustainability. Renowned for its natural beauty, the city has become a magnet for professionals eager to create environmental solutions, and with an emphasis on clean technology, renewable energy and environmental innovation, it's attracted companies across various industries, all working toward a shared goal: advancing clean technology.
